"I saw Ibn 'Umar dyeing his beard yellow with Khaluq and I said: 'O Abu 'Abdur-Rahman, are you dyeing your beard yellow with Khaluq?' He said: 'I saw the Messenger of Allah dyeing his beard yellow with it, and there was no other kind of dye that was dearer to him than this. He used to dye all of his clothes with it, even his 'Imamah (turban).'"
The Prophet of Allah disliked ten things: Yellow dye, meaning Khaluq, changing gray hair, dragging one's Izar, wearing gold rings, playing with dice (Ki'ab), (a woman) showing her adornment to people to whom it is not permissible for her to show it, reciting Ruqyah, unless it is with Al-Mu'awidhat (Verses seeking refuge with Allah), hanging amulets, removing to ejaculate in other than the right place, and taking away the milk of an infant boy (by having intercourse with his mother)-…
"I saw Mu'awiyah bin Abi Sufyan on the Minbar, holding a ball of hair such as women use. He said: "What is wrong with Muslim women who put such things (on their heads)? I heard the Messenger of Allah say: "Any woman who adds hair to her head that is not hers, it is something false, that she is adding to her head."
"The Messenger of Allah cursed the one who consumes Riba, the one who pays it, the one who witnesses it and the one who writes it down; the woman who does tattoos and the woman who has that done; and forbade wailing (in mourning), but he did not say that its doer is cursed."
He and a companion of his used to stay with Abu Raihanah to learn good things from him. He said: "One day my companion came and told me that he heard Abu Raihanah say: 'The Messenger of Allah forbade filing (the teeth), tattoos, and plucking hairs.'"
"We heard that the Messenger of Allah forbade filing (the teeth) and tattoos."
The Messenger of Allah said: "One of the best kinds of kohl that you use is Ithmid (antimony); it brightens the vision and makes the hair (eye-lashes) grow."
"I heard Jabir bin Samurah being asked about the gray hairs of the Prophet . He said: 'If he put oil on his head they could not be seen, but if he did not put oil on his head, they could be seen.'"

"I was sitting with the Messenger of Allah and he saw that I was dressed in scruffy clothes. He said: 'Do you have any wealth?' I said: 'Yes, O Messenger of Allah, all kinds of wealth.' He said: 'If Allah gives you wealth then let its effect be seen on you.'"
The Prophet forbade Al-Qaza' (shaving part of the head and leaving part)."
That he had long thick hair. "He asked the Prophet (about it) and he told him to take care of it and comb it every day."
"I saw Ibn 'Umar dyeing his beard yellow and I asked him about that. 'He said: "I saw the Prophet dye his beard yellow."
"Mu'awiyah came to Al-Madinah and addressed us. He took hold of a hairpiece and said: 'I never used to see anyone do this except the Jews. The Messenger of Allah heard of it and he called it "giving a false impression."
"Abdullah used to say: 'May Allah curse the women who have tattoos done and Al-Mutanammisat, and have the women who have their teeth separated. Should I not curse those whom the Messenger of Allah cursed?'"
"The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) forbade men to use saffron on their skin."
"The Prophet mentioned a woman who filled her ring with musk and said: 'That is the best of perfume.'"
"The Messenger of Allah forbade me from reciting Qur'an while bowing."
"The Messenger of Allah said: 'I used to wear this ring, but I will never wear it again.' Then he threw it away, and the people threw their rings away."
The Prophet put on a silver ring with and Ethiopian stone (Fass), on which the inscription was: "Muhammad Rasul Allah."
The Messenger of Allah took a ring and put it on, then he said: "This distracted me from you all day, shifting my gaze from it to you (and back again)." Then he threw it away.
"I saw Zainab, the daughter of the Prophet , wearing a Qamis of Sira'."
"A Hullah of Sira' was given to the Messenger of Allah and he sent it to me. I put it on, then I saw anger in his face. He said: 'I did not give it to you to wear it.' Then he told me to divide it among my womenfolk."
"I heard 'Abdullah bin Az-Zubair say: 'Do not let your womenfolk wear silk, for I heard 'Umar bin Al-Khattab say: The Messenger of Allah said: Whoever wears it in this world will not wear it in the Hereafter.'"
The Messenger of Allah saw him wearing two garments dyed with safflower and he said: "This is the clothing of disbelievers; do not wear it."
"The Messenger of Allah came out to us wearing two green garments."
The Prophet said: "Wear white garments, for they are purer and better, and shroud your dead in them."
"The Messenger of Allah said: 'You should wear white garments; dress your living ones in them, and shroud your dead in them, for they are among the best of your garments.'"

"The Prophet entered (Makkah) on the Day of the Conquest wearing a black turban."
"The metallic end of the scabbard of the Messenger of Allah was of silver, the pommel of his sword was silver, and in between were rings of silver."
